This is, without a doubt, the most crucial aspect of responsible gambling. Think of your bankroll as your war chest. It’s the money you’ve allocated specifically for gambling, and it needs to be protected. The golden rule? Never gamble with money you can’t afford to lose. Set a budget *before* you start playing, and stick to it religiously. This means knowing your limits and walking away when you’ve reached them, whether you’re up or down. A good strategy is to allocate a specific percentage of your bankroll to each session. For example, if you have a $1,000 bankroll, you might decide to risk no more than 2% ($20) per spin on slots, or 5% ($50) per hand in a game like blackjack. This helps to protect your bankroll from rapid depletion during a losing streak.
Consider using a tracking system to monitor your wins and losses. This can be as simple as a spreadsheet or a dedicated gambling app. Tracking your results helps you identify trends, assess your performance, and make adjustments to your strategy as needed. It also provides a clear picture of your overall profitability (or lack thereof), which is essential for making informed decisions about your gambling habits.
Not all casino games are created equal. Some offer better odds than others. Understanding the house edge – the statistical advantage the casino has over you – is critical. Games like blackjack, when played with optimal strategy, have a relatively low house edge. Video poker, especially variations with favorable pay tables, can also offer good odds. On the flip side, games like slots often have a higher house edge, meaning the casino has a greater advantage. Consider researching the theoretical return to player (RTP) percentage of different slots games before you play. The higher the RTP, the better your chances of winning over the long run.
Don’t be afraid to experiment with different games. Try out a few different options to see what you enjoy and what suits your playing style. But remember, once you find a game you like, take the time to learn the rules and develop a solid strategy. This is especially important for games like poker and blackjack, where your decisions can significantly impact your chances of winning. Practice in free play mode before risking real money to get a feel for the game and refine your skills.
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ward existing ones. These can range from welcome bonuses to free spins to loyalty programs. Take advantage of these offers, but always read the terms and conditions carefully. Pay close attention to wagering requirements (the amount you need to bet before you can withdraw your winnings), game restrictions (which games contribute towards the wagering requirements), and expiry dates. Some bonuses are more advantageous than others. Look for bonuses with reasonable wagering requirements and games that contribute fully towards those requirements. Don’t chase bonuses blindly; always consider the potential value and the likelihood of meeting the terms.
Gambling involves variance – the short-term fluctuations in your results. Even with a sound strategy, you’ll experience winning streaks and losing streaks. It’s crucial to understand that these are normal and unavoidable. Don’t let a losing streak discourage you or tempt you to chase your losses. Chasing losses is a surefire way to lose more money. Stick to your bankroll management plan and avoid increasing your bets to recoup losses. Similarly, don’t let a winning streak lead to reckless decisions. Stay disciplined and stick to your strategy, even when you’re feeling on top of the world.
Emotional control is paramount. Gambling can be highly emotional, especially when money is involved. Learn to recognize your emotional triggers and develop strategies to manage them. If you find yourself getting frustrated, angry, or overly excited, take a break. Walk away from the game, clear your head, and return when you’re feeling calm and rational. Avoid gambling when you’re under the influence of alcohol or drugs, as this can impair your judgment and lead to poor decisions.
